Hello readers! The next selection for the WUUC Nonfiction Book Club is Homelessness is a Housing Problem by Gregg Colburn.  Homelessness is a Housing Problem (homelessnesshousingproblem.com) Cities across the country are grappling with growing challenges of homelessness, but the size of the homeless population varies widely from place to place. In some cities, like Los Angeles (CA) and […]
